For anyone who’s still interested in the Creative Collective, I want to dust off the cobwebs and reintroduce it in a way that feels fulfilling and awesome for the both of us.
Previously, I’d do each CC prompt and host a linkup here on my blog, where you could share your own projects with other participants. Now, instead of doing a linkup, I’d love to utilize social media and have us share our projects using the hashtag #TNCCreativeCollective. Using a hashtag will work similarly to having a linkup, since you can easily search it on Twitter and Instagram and find others who shared their own take on the same project! If enough people participate, I’ll also be sharing my favorite participant projects (with a link to your blog) in roundups here on my site. I’ll also retweet or re-Instagram any tagged (#TNCCreativeCollective) projects that catch my eye.
